1. Preheat the oven to 190 degrees. Whisk butter and sugar in an average bowl with an electric mixer. Add eggs, beat well and mix mass with flour. 2. Dissolve the soda in the buttermilk, then add to the cooked dough together with the orange peel. Stir well until smooth. If you do not have buttermilk, you can add 1 tablespoon of white vinegar to slightly less than 1 cup of milk. 3. Lubricate the muffin mold and lightly sprinkle with flour. Fill in the forms for 2/3 of their volume. This recipe produces about 36 muffins or 3 large forms. 4. Bake muffins at 190 degrees from 12 to 17 minutes (or 20-25 minutes for regular cupcakes) until the muffins are browned. 5. To prepare the orange glaze, in a separate bowl, mix the brown sugar and juice from the oranges. Mix well the mass. You should get about a cup. Pour the frosting onto warm muffins.

Servings: 36
